Opposition Congress on Wednesday moved privilege motions against two Odisha ministers for allegedly misleading the House and a BJP legislator for misnterpretating the comments of the Congress Legislature Party leader.

Immediately after the question hour in the Assembly, Barabati-Cuttack MLA Mohammed Moquim moved a privilege notice against Odisha Agriculture and Farmer Empowerment Minister Arun Kumar Sahoo and demanded his resignation.

"I moved the privilege motion against the minister as he has attempted to mislead the House by giving facts not based on truth," Moquim told reporters outside the House.

The Congress lawmaker in his privilege notice said, "While replying a question on November 13, the minister has said that the state has identified 45,965 ineligible beneficiaries under the KALIA Yojana. But the information under RTI Act revealed that (there are) 1,72,908 ineligible beneficiaries under the scheme only in 10 districts of the state."
He said, "In view of this, the Honble Agriculture and Farmers Empowerment Minister deserve to be punished for the breach of privilege."
